The University of Deusto dressed up on March 21 to celebrate Tourism Alumni Day, an event commemorating the 60th anniversary of tourism studies, in which alumni, students and teachers gathered in an emotional meeting, under the title “A journey through time, heading to the future”, full of memories, experiences and looks to the future. 

After the welcome by Fernando Bayón, Vice Dean of Research and Doctoral Studies of the Faculty of Social and Human Sciences, and Jesús Riaño, Director of Deusto Alumni, the event became a real time machine to relive the evolution of tourism and education in the sector. From the old classrooms to the latest technological innovations, the tour showed how tourism studies in Deusto have been able to adapt to the demands of a sector in constant transformation.

Through videos and testimonials, the beginnings of tourism education were recalled and the revolution brought about by digitalization was reflected upon: from paper maps to virtual reality glasses and the metaverse, tools that today are redefining the way in which tourism is designed and experienced. Former students will share their experiences and their vision of the past, present and future of the profession.

One of the most special moments of the day was the tribute to the first graduating class of tourism, who received recognition for their key role in the consolidation of these studies and their contribution to the development of the sector.

This event, organized by Deusto Alumni and the Faculty of Social and Human Sciences, reaffirms the link between the university and its graduates, consolidating a meeting place for the exchange of experiences and the projection of the new challenges of the sector.
